Precision as the Anchor of Complex Operations
Precision drives effective logistics coordination, and when multiple processes intersect, accuracy in timing, communication, and execution determines if operations are stable. Even small deviations can introduce delays that expand across an entire system.
Gendron has worked in roles where precision is a daily requirement. Shipment coordination, vendor communication, and client expectations must align without error. Each interaction carries weight, and consistency becomes the mechanism that keeps operations on track.
Precision also builds confidence. Teams operate more effectively when they trust that information is accurate and responsibilities are clearly defined. Clarity allows faster decision-making and reduces hesitation.
Controlling Timing Across Interconnected Processes
Timing acts as the framework within which logistics operate. Every movement, update, and decision depends on synchronized execution. Without control over timing, coordination becomes fragmented. Gendron points to the importance of maintaining timing discipline even when conditions shift.
“Strong coordination comes from timing that remains consistent, even when the environment changes, because stability in execution allows teams to adjust without losing alignment,” he says. “When timing is predictable, each part of the operation can respond with confidence, knowing how and when to act despite shifting conditions.”
Consistent timing reduces friction, supports faster decision-making, and keeps complex systems moving forward without unnecessary disruption. Control at this level requires structured planning and reliable communication patterns.
Operations that maintain timing stability avoid cascading disruptions. When one element adjusts, the rest of the system adapts without losing pace, supporting continuity across complex workflows.
Clarity in Communication as a Stabilizing Force
Communication clarity reduces risk in complex logistics environments. Teams rely on precise updates to understand status, identify priorities, and take action. Ambiguity introduces delays and increases the likelihood of error.
Gendron has seen how structured communication supports operational control in logistics. Information must be delivered in a way that eliminates uncertainty. Teams should know what has changed, what actions are required, and what timelines are affected.
“Clear communication prevents small issues from turning into larger disruptions by ensuring that concerns are identified and addressed before they have time to escalate. When information is shared early and with precision, teams can respond quickly, make informed adjustments, and maintain alignment across every stage of an operation,” says Gendron.
Without that clarity, minor gaps can compound, creating delays and confusion that are far more difficult to resolve later. Prevention becomes critical in systems where timing and coordination are tightly linked.
Consistency in communication also strengthens alignment across teams, so when expectations are clear, coordination improves naturally.
Establishing Control Through Structured Processes
Control in logistics is rarely achieved through constant intervention. It must be established through structured processes that guide execution.
Standard operating procedures, verification steps, and defined workflows create consistency. Gendron notes that structure supports performance as opposed to limiting it.
“Well-defined processes allow teams to operate with speed while maintaining accuracy,” he says.
Structured processes reduce variation and protect against oversight. Teams working within these frameworks gain confidence in execution. They spend less time correcting errors and more time maintaining forward movement.
As operations expand, structured processes become increasingly important. Complexity increases, and the need for consistency becomes more pronounced.
Cross-Functional Coordination and Shared Awareness
Logistics coordination extends across multiple functions, so procurement, operations, transportation, and client-facing teams must operate within a shared framework. Alignment across these groups determines overall performance.
In his vast career, Gendron has operated in environments where cross-functional coordination in supply chains is essential. Vendor relationships, internal planning, and client communication must be synchronized to maintain stability.
Shared awareness strengthens coordination. Teams that understand how their actions affect others respond more effectively. Clear ownership ensures that responsibilities are executed without delay.
Alignment also improves adaptability. When teams operate with a shared understanding, adjustments can be made quickly without introducing confusion.

Leveraging Technology for Visibility and Responsiveness
Technology enhances logistics coordination by improving visibility. Real-time tracking, integrated systems, and communication platforms provide insight into operational status.
Gendron, who has worked in environments where visibility supports decision-making, believes that access to accurate information allows teams to anticipate challenges and respond quickly.
Technology is most effective when paired with disciplined processes. Data must be interpreted clearly and acted upon consistently. Without structure, information can overwhelm and is no longer helpful.
When used effectively, technology strengthens coordination and supports faster, more informed decisions.
